H A Dfile.c9e78d14a Tue Dec 10 09:26:48 CST 2013 David Howells <dhowells@redhat.com> Use %pd in eCryptFS

Use the new %pd printk() specifier in eCryptFS to replace passing of dentry
name or dentry name and name length * 2 with just passing the dentry.
